Description
Tried, true and tested the Power Commander continues to evolve with the Power Commander 6. Developed to simplify the user experience, PC6 makes choosing and tuning a map easier for the end user. All the same benefits you have relied on for over 20 years remain to keep you at the front of the pack.
The Power Commander 6 fuel injection tuning device allows you to optimize your fuel and timing curve (where applicable) giving you the confidence to roam freely. With fine tune adjustability and multiple inputs, the Power Commander 6 will keep your vehicle running at its full potential letting you concentrate on the journey ahead.
Featuring a plug-and-play setup, Power Commander 6 can be installed discreetly underneath your seat, cowl, dash or other location ensuring your ride looks as good as it runs. Removing the device reverts your vehicle completely back to stock. With the ability to store and switch between two maps on-the-fly (via the map switch accessory) and connect to various Power Commander accessories such as the Autotune, Quickshifter or POD-300, the Power Commander 6 gives you features and functions that provide you with the ultimate ride.
FEATURES
- Adjustment of +/-15 in the FUEL table and +/- 8 in the timing table (if applicable).
- Compact design for discrete placement & easy uninstallation to revert to stock settings
- Easily change & upgrade tunes as you upgrade parts
- Comes with Power Core software that connects dyno runs with our EFI Tuning Devices to unlock your ride’s potential
- Pair with other Power Commander accessories like the Autotune, Quickshifter or POD-300
- Analog input allows you to install any 0-5 volt sensor and build an adjustment table based on its input such as boost or temperature
- Easily connects to your computer via USB
- Each cylinder can be mapped individually and for each gear, giving riders more granular control
- One year warranty
- Proudly made in the USA

Yamaha WR450F Dirt Bike (2003-2026)
The Yamaha WR450F, an iconic off-road and enduro motorcycle, was introduced in 2003 and has continued to evolve through 2026. Powered by a 449cc (often rounded to 450cc) liquid-cooled, four-stroke engine, it is renowned for its versatility and off-road performance. While generally offered as a single model without distinct trim levels, the WR450F has undergone several major redesigns over the years. Early versions, from 2003 to 2011, were carbureted. A significant change occurred in 2012 with the adoption of electronic fuel injection and a new aluminum frame based on the YZ450F, enhancing handling and power delivery. Other notable evolutions include the introduction of the "reversed" engine design in 2015 and substantial engine and chassis updates in 2019 and 2021, aimed at optimizing enduro performance and efficiency. Maintenance
| Component | Interval | Details |
| Engine Oil and Oil Filter | Every 1,000 km or 5 rides (2003); Every 10 h (recreational) or 5 h (aggressive/race) for other years | Replace filter with each oil change. Approximately 1.1 L of oil with filter change. |
| Air Filter | After break-in and every race (2003); Every 15 h (recreational) or 5 h (aggressive/race) for most years | Clean and re-oil regularly. Inspect and replace if damaged. Interval may be 10 h for recreational riding on some years (e.g., 2015). |
| Spark Plug | Inspection every 500 km or every 3 races (2003); Inspection after break-in and every race (2006) | Periodic inspection is recommended for all model years. |
| Coolant | Check level before each ride | Inspect hoses for leaks or wear. |
| Drive Chain | Every 5-10 h | Clean and lubricate. The WR450F uses a chain, not a belt. |
